An interesting piece of statistical information was reveal in a UK court hearing in 2007, which involves a world largest marketing group operating in UK since 1973. It is reported through The Times online that out of 390,000 agents, 10% makes a profit, while 71% make no income for Year 2005-2006. 90% make a lost after making their renewal fee of 18£.
